Transaction 4125253134b071b0ad4d988c1b2c130cbd61faff761826aec166b24bf93e78a3

1 Input
2 Outputs
  • 4125253134b071b0ad4d988c1b2c130cbd61faff761826aec166b24bf93e78a3:0
  • value  315656
    address  3QpVMUyuzXVRhGyoxNKLr4VbhrFrZA3quZ
  • 4125253134b071b0ad4d988c1b2c130cbd61faff761826aec166b24bf93e78a3:1
  • value  27150655
    address  bc1qng4xpu6rxvyw9jdnz8tp3t4yh0htjwlvz7dffg